Chiefs DT Isaiah Buggs turns himself in to police, charged with animal cruelty

Kansas City Chiefs defensive tackle Isaiah Buggs turned himself into Tuscaloosa Police on Thursday after following arrest warrants were issued against him for animal cruelty. According to WIAT Birmingham, Buggs is charged with two counts of second-degree animal cruelty after two starving and dirty dogs were found on a Tuscaloosa property he was renting. A […]
